Lewis heads to Silverstone in confident mood

Nineteen year-old Ryan Lewis heads to Silverstone this weekend (17/18 April) aiming for another double victory in the Avon Tyres British Formula 3 Scholarship. The BES Plc-backed driver from Royston tasted the victors champagne twice in the opening rounds at Donington Park two weeks ago and is now determined to repeat that success, which was backed up by two pole positions and fastest laps.

Driving a T-Sport Dallara Mugen-Honda the teenager, who celebrates his 20th birthday next week, had a successful test utilising part of the Northamptonshire track several weeks ago but this Friday's morning session will be his first experience of the full International circuit. “Of course I'm a little apprehensive about the weekend as it'll be the first time I've raced on the International circuit and I've never even seen the track before,” said Ryan.

“During the test session last month though I managed to get to grips with some of the corners we'll use this weekend and providing Friday's test goes well too, I'll be looking forward to another good weekend. I feel confident of a good result; the Silverstone track is really quick and if it stays dry should be good.”

Ryan's main opposition this weekend looks likely to come from Barton Mawer and Stephen Jelley, who took a second apiece at Donington to trail him in the points standings. Ryan's performance at Donington though when he ran as high as 8th overall, shows he's more than capable of running with the Championship class contenders and on the ultra-quick Silverstone track next Sunday, will be aiming for a strong overall finish as well as double victory.

Avon Tyres British Scholarship Points after 2 rounds

1. RYAN LEWIS 42
2. Stephen Jelley 23
3. Ajit Kumar 18
4. Barton Mawer 15
5. Adam Langley-Khan 12
6. Vasilije Casalan 10
